easyui的menu接收后台集合,并且根据集合利用appendItem动态生成菜单项,判断菜单项的字数大于指定长度,则多余字符以。。。显示,并且悬浮提示
JSP: <a id="bb" href="javascript:void(0);" class="easyui-menubutton" data-options="menu:'#layout_north_stMenu222',iconCls:'icon-cologne-sign-out'" >导出</a> <div id="aaa" style="width: 100px; display: none;"> <div id='mdm0'>到清单 </div> </div> JS: var url="...发送post请求"; $.post(url,data,function(data){ if (data.rows && data.total>0){//每个菜单项是一个row if($('#bb').length > 0){ var menubutton = $($('#bb').menubutton('options').menu); var menu = menubutton.menu('findItem','到'+costTypeNameArr[index]);//增加父菜单项 for(var i=0;i<data.total;i++) { //循环增加子菜单项 menubutton.menu('appendItem',{ parent:menu.target,/